Every element of society works to meet a need to contribute to the whole of. All parts of an orderly society are integrated with each other but work society independently. Manifest function: the obvious and intended (e. g. safety) Mechanical solidarity: in small communities that have extreme dependence on each other, one mistake affects everyone = punishment is strong, swift, and even violent. Latent functions: less obvious and unintended (e. g. employment created) Organic solidarity: more complex societies where there is mutual dependence, one breaks the law and the whole machine doesn"t break down. How existing social arrangements always represent the powerful against the weaker members of society. The media discourages activity that will not benefit the rich, and those who are most punished are those who do not follow these laws. Some say police are a part of the working class- it"s a job and its dangerous, and others say they are just workers for the ruling class.
